A Delhi court has issued two non-bailable warrants (NBW) against MNS chief Raj Thackeray for humiliating the people of Uttar Pradesh and Bihar.
The court was hearing seven petitions against Thackeray. Issuing the two NBWs, Additional Chief Metropolitan Magistrate Manish Yaduvanshi maintained that Thackeray was promoting enmity between different groups.
The application for initiating proceedings was made by lawyers Sudhir Kumar Ojha from Bihar and Sudhir Kumar from Jharkhand.

Ojha said that Thackeray humiliated people from Bihar and UP in a February 2008 speech by ridiculing Chhath Puja.
